This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Lodgify, a fast-growing company in the vacation rental industry, is seeking a Senior Frontend Developer to join their multicultural startup team in Barcelona.
The role involves maintaining and adding features to the existing Frontend application built with React.
Responsibilities include implementing new features using technologies like TypeScript, React, SWR, and styled-components.
Collaborate closely with the product and development team to shape the product, focusing on testing, performance, and code quality.
Enhance a modern cross-browser compatible application by utilizing the latest Web APIs and features.
Participate in front-end discussions and propose initiatives to enhance the codebase.
Requirements:
Minimum 4+ years of experience with React.
Strong foundations in JavaScript, Typescript, HTML, and CSS.
Proficient in Git and experience working with mono-repositories.
Ability to write unit and integration tests, with experience in interaction tests using Storybook or E2E tests using Playwright as a bonus.
Capable of delivering accessible, mobile-responsive, performant, and scalable solutions.
Experience collaborating with designers and validating technical feasibility of their ideas.
Familiarity with Agile Principles (Kanban, Scrum) and working with REST APIs.
Experience setting up contracts with back-end developers.
Benefits:
Work remotely with the freedom to work from home.
Enjoy 25 working days of paid vacation and Jornada Intensiva in August.
Receive top-notch Cigna health insurance, including travel insurance, dental plan, and psychologist services.
Save on meals and transportation with the Flexible Remuneration plan.
Get a home-office setup allowance for a productive work environment.
Travel to biyearly team-building events in Barcelona at the company's expense.
Access free Spanish classes.
Participate in the referral program for paid compensation and boost earning potential.
Experience a great culture and working environment with an international team of over 60 different nationalities.